Address 0 PPC

PMpnBBSFTwoCn6AGGaYfuonWzN59Xrxtrq

Confirmed

Total Received27.66895 PPC
Total Sent27.66895 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PMpnBBSFTwoCn6AGGaYfuonWzN59Xrxtrq27.66895 PPC
Fee: 0.01 PPC
671852 Confirmations27.65895 PPC
PMpnBBSFTwoCn6AGGaYfuonWzN59Xrxtrq27.66895 PPC
P9w7q4S9Dm2vw83kRRwKzCCyecevUxBSah1.994108 PPC ×
Fee: 0.01 PPC
671864 Confirmations29.663058 PPC